Why PCB Prototyping Is Essential
A prototype PCB is the first physical version of your circuit board. It enables engineers to test electrical performance, verify component placement, evaluate thermal behavior, and identify design flaws before investing in mass production.
Choosing a reliable prototype PCB manufacturer for accurate product testing and validation helps ensure that potential issues are identified early. Detecting problems during the prototyping stage is significantly less expensive than correcting them after production has begun.
High-quality prototypes also provide valuable insights that improve the performance, durability, and reliability of the final product.
Better Manufacturing Leads to Better Products
Even the best PCB design can fail if it is poorly manufactured. Precision fabrication is essential for maintaining trace accuracy, hole alignment, copper thickness, and solder mask quality.
An experienced manufacturer follows strict production standards and advanced quality control procedures throughout every stage of fabrication. This attention to detail results in prototypes that accurately reflect the intended design.

Engineering Expertise Reduces Design Errors
One of the biggest advantages of partnering with an experienced PCB manufacturer is access to engineering support.
Professional engineering teams review Gerber files, perform Design for Manufacturability (DFM) analysis, and identify potential production challenges before fabrication begins. These recommendations often improve manufacturability while reducing unnecessary production costs.

Comprehensive Testing Ensures Accuracy
Reliable prototype PCB manufacturers perform extensive testing before shipping completed boards.
Inspection methods such as Automated Optical Inspection (AOI), Flying Probe Testing, electrical testing, X-ray inspection, and final visual inspection help identify defects before prototypes reach the customer.
